DETAILS ABOUT SERVICE REDUCTIONS STARTING MARCH 30, 2020
Longueuil, March 28, 2020 — As recently announced, the Réseau de transport de Longueuil (RTL) will reduce its bus and shared taxi service starting Monday, March 30, 2020, in response to the coronavirus pandemic. Full details about the schedule changes are now available on the RTL website at https://bit.ly/2UFXbGO.
The Saturday schedule will now apply on weekdays, and service on certain additional lines will be reduced.

The Réseau de transport de Longueuil (RTL) is the main transit provider for individuals within the five cities that comprise the Agglomération de Longueuil.
The third-largest public transit organization in Québec, the RTL operates a network of 793 kilometres. With some 1,100 employees, the RTL is a major employer that contributes to the economic vitality of the region.
